Soak up smooth sounds at SFJAZZ Center in Hayes Valley, which puts on more than 300 shows a season featuring top artists, up-and-coming musicians and the resident all-star ensemble. Or bop over to Fillmore Street, the city’s historic jazz district, for intimate performances at clubs like the Boom Boom Room and Sheba Piano Lounge .
